BHOPAL (Metro Rail News): Larsen & Toubro was chosen as the low bidder to provide and construct standard gauge tracks for the underground, elevated, and Subhash Nagar Depot of Bhopal Metro Phase 1.

Madhya Pradesh Metro Rail Corporation Ltd. (MPMRCL) floats tender for this contract (Package BH-07) financed by the European Investment Bank (EIB)  in February with an unspecified completion date of 1274 days (3.49 years).

In July, technical bids were opened, revealing 4 bidders. RVNL and VNC were rejected because their proposals did not adhere to the requirements of the tender.

FirmBid (Rs. Crore)
Larsen & Toubro Ltd. (L&T)238.52
Texmaco Rail and Engineering Ltd. (TexRail)248.86
Rail Vikas Nigam Ltd. (RVNL)Disqualified
Vijay Nirman Company Pvt. Ltd. (VNC)Disqualified

The Work includes:  Design Supply Installation Testing and Commissioning of Ballastless Track of Standard Gauge including Supply of Fastening System including Elevated and Underground sections along with Ballasted Ballastless Track in Depot for Bhopal Metro Rail Project.

It is the 4th and final track-related contract for Bhopal’s 27.87 km Phase 1 project. The previous 3 have been clubbed together with Indore Metro’s Phase 1.

MUMBAI (Metro Rail News): The Mumbai Metropolitan Region Development Authority (MMRDA) floated tenders for the construction of the Kasheli Depot on the Mumbai Metro Orange Line (Line-5) (Package CA-151).

The metro train depot (car shed), together with accompanying infrastructure, is slated to be constructed on a 27.13 hectare land parcel directly south of Kasheli metro station, which is under construction by Afcons Infrastructure in north-east Mumbai.

A 690m test track, a stabling shed (SBL) with 30 lines, a workshop shed (WSL) space with 3 lines, and an inspection shed (IBL) area with 4 lines will be included in addition to administrative facilities.

Package Name:  CA-151

The work includes:  Construction of Depot Infrastructures comprising Stabling Yard, Operation Control Centre and Administrative building, Maintenance and workshop buildings, Auxiliary substation, Finishing, Plumbing, Earthworks for land development, Compound wall, Road, Approach Bridge and Underground Utility Duct Works, Drainage, Rain Water Harvesting, Staff Quarters etc. Complete Including Architectural Finishing works and PEB Works for Car Depot at Kasheli for Metro Line-5 of Mumbai Metro Rail Project of MMRDA

Estimated Cost: 472.02

Period of Work: 36 months (3 years)

NEW DELHI (Metro Rail News): The Delhi-Ghaziabad-Meerut corridor of India’s first RRTS witnessed the first tunnel breakthrough in Meerut on 22nd October 2022. Sudarshan 8.3 (TBM) made a breakthrough from the tunnel at the Begumpul RRTS station.

Mr Vinay Kumar Singh, MD, NCRTC, initiated the breakthrough by pressing a remote button in presence of the Directors and other senior officials of NCRTC. The Sudarshan 8.3, Tunnel Boring Machine (TBM), was lowered at the launching shaft constructed at Gandhi Park and will now be retrieved from the Begumpul RRTS station. This has been achieved within 4 months after completing the boring and formation of a 750 m-long tunnel.

This is the first drive of tunnelling completed by Sudarshan 8.3. The same TBM will also construct the parallel tunnel. Hence, the TBM will be dismantled in the shaft and its cutter head and shield will be brought back to the launching shaft at Gandhi Park on trailers. The backup gantry or the rest of the parts of the TBM will be sent back from the tunnel itself. Once it reaches the launching shaft, it will then be re-launched.

Meanwhile, two other Sudarshan, 8.1 and 8.2, are boring 1.8 km long parallel tunnels from Bhaisali to Football Chawk.

Begumpul RRTS station is being constructed through a Top-Down technique, in which the station is built from top to bottom along with deep excavations. This station has three levels: mezzanine, concourse, and platform level. The Mezzanine and concourse level of this station have been completed and the construction of the platform level is being carried out at present.

To construct this 750 m-long tunnel, over 3500 pre-casted segments have been used. In the tunnelling process, these segments are inserted and seven segments are combined to make one ring. Each segment is 1.5 m long and 275 mm thick. These segments and rings are connected with the help of bolts. The Tunnel Segments are being cast at NCRTC’s Casting Yard in Shatabdi Nagar with assured quality control. Pre-casting helps in the safe and fast execution of the works while ensuring good quality control, minimizing inconvenience to the road users, local passers-by, business owners and residents along the entire stretch, and reduction in air pollution & noise pollution.

Due to the bigger rolling stock and a high design speed of 180 kmph, the diameter of the RRTS tunnels being constructed is 6.5 m. Compared to the metro systems, this is for the first time that a tunnel of such a large size is being constructed in the country.

The project is being implemented as per the scheduled timeline. To expedite the process, parallel construction was being carried out, where on one hand, the launching shaft was being constructed; on the other, segments of the ring were being pre-casted in the casting yard. Also at the same time, FAT (Factory Acceptance Test) checking of TBM was being done and parts of this technologically advanced machine were being brought to the site. It is due to the far-sightedness and premeditated efforts that the project is coming along in a timely manner, despite two waves of the pandemic.

Meerut Central, Bhaisali, and Begumpul are the underground stations in Meerut, out of which Meerut Central and Bhaisali are the Meerut Metro Stations whereas Begumpul Station will serve as both RRTS and Metro. NCRTC is going to provide local transit services, Meerut Metro, on the RRTS network itself in Meerut with 13 stations in the span of 21 km for local transit needs.

BANGALORE (Metro Rail News): The first trial run of a six-coach train between Whitefield Depot and Pattandur Agrahara (ITPL) Station was successfully completed on 21st October. The start of the trial is very important because it is 3.5-km long, which includes four stops, and is a component of Bengaluru Metro’s Phase- II of the Baiyappanahalli-Whitefield line. Employees of IT companies have been anxiously awaiting its launch for years.

50 individuals, including employees of Bangalore Metro Rail Corporation Limited (BMRCL) and Bharat Earth Movers Limited (BEML), which provided BMRCL with the new coaches boarded the train.

“We began the trial run at 12.20pm from Whitefield depot and ended it at 1.40pm, running at a speed of 15km per hour. It was a smooth ride, the track was done well and we had no issues,” said BMRCL MD Anjum Parwez, travelling on the debut run with N M Dhoke, Director of Rolling Stock, Electrical and Operations & Maintenance, and Jitendra Jha, Project Manager, Rolling Stock.

Parwez said, “The full train was dragged for a distance of 100 metres from the starting point of the depot on a massive trailer as the third rail (750V power line) is located a bit far for safety reasons. The train took the upward ramp from the depot to Whitefield station. We crossed Channasandra and Kadugodi stations before terminating at ITPL.

Parwez said the trials will gradually touch Garudacharpalya, and will be over by February 2023, after which the CMRS processes will be done. “We will then discuss with the government and take a call on whether this stretch alone can be made operational or we will launch the entire line. Simultaneously, work on the pending portion from K R Puram to Baiyappanahalli will be done,” he said.

CHENNAI (Metro Rail News): 6 firms submitted bids for 2 different contracts to commission the electrification system for lines 3 and 5 of the Chennai Metro (OHE, RSS, ASS, & SCADA) after Chennai Metro Rail Ltd. (CMRL) released technical bids on 17th October.

Both of these lines, which are now under construction as part of Chennai Metro’s 118.9 km Phase 2 project, would connect Madhavaram – SIPCOT (Line-3, 45.813 km) and Madhavaram – Sholinganallur (Line-5, 47 km) with a combination of elevated and underground stations.

The 25 km Madhavaram Milk Colony – Sholinganallur stretch of Line-3 and the 23 km Madhavaram Milk Colony – CMBT section of Line-5 are covered under these two electrification system contracts.

CMRL had floated tenders for both contracts in October 2021 with an unknown estimate and 2350-day (6.44 year) completion deadlines.

Bidders for OHE Contract are:

Kalpataru Power Transmission Ltd.

KEC International Ltd.

Larsen & Toubro Ltd.

Linxon India Pvt Ltd.

Rail Vikas Nigam Ltd.

Texmaco Rail and Engineering Ltd.

The work includes: Design, manufacturing, supply, installation, testing, training and commissioning of OHE and Switching Stations for CMRL Phase II Corridor 3 (From Madhavaram Milk Colony to Sholinganallur) and Corridor 5 (Madhavaram Milk Colony to CMBT, including Depot at Madhavaram)

Bidders for RSS, ASS and SCADA Contract

Larsen & Toubro Ltd.

Linxon India Pvt. Ltd.

Rail Vikas Nigam Ltd.

The work includes: Design, manufacturing, supply, installation, testing, training and commissioning of RSS, ASS and SCADA for CMRL Phase II Corridor 3 (From Madhavaram Milk Colony to Sholinganallur) and Corridor 5 (Madhavaram Milk Colony to CMBT, including Depot at Madhavaram).

The bids have been sent for technical evaluation process, which can take few months to complete. The financial bids submitted by the technically qualified bidders will be opened to identify the lowest bidder and most likely contractor for each contract.

Linxon India was acknowledged as the lowest bidder for the electrification contract for the southern section of both lines back in September. They cover the 24 km CMBT – Sholinganallur part of Line-5 and the 20 km Sholinganallur – SIPCOT 2 section of Line-3.

Siemens emerges as the lowest bidder for the electrification contract of Line-4 in May.

NEW DELHI (Metro Rail News): India’s fourth Vande Bharat express train from Amb Andaura to New Delhi, which was inaugurated by Prime Minister Narendra Modi in Una, Himachal Pradesh has completed its first public run on 19th October.

It left the New Delhi railway station at roughly 5:50 am as scheduled and traveled through Chandigarh and Ambala Cantonment, arriving at 8 am and 8:40 am, respectively, to arrive at its destination at 11:05 pm.

On the return trip, the train left at 1 pm and arrived at Chandigarh and Ambala Cantonment at 3:25 pm and 4:06 pm, respectively, before reaching the national capital at 6:30 pm. There were few delays reported for both journeys.

According to data provided by the Ambala Railway Division’s reservation and ticketing department, approximately 50% of tickets on the train from Chandigarh to New Delhi were booked.

As many as 64 reservations were registered in the executive class and 474 tickets were booked in chair car, out of total of 1,126 seats available seats, an official said.

From Ambala Cantonment, at least 70 passengers boarded the train bound for New Delhi.

However, based on rough estimates, the number of reservations on the first day from New Delhi to Chandigarh was less than 25%.
Officials said the train is an advanced version compared to the earlier ones, being much lighter and capable of reaching higher speeds in a shorter duration.

NEW DELHI (Metro Rail News): The first of eight planned regional rapid rail corridors in the capital region will connect Delhi to key cities and sub-urban areas in the surrounding states – Haryana, Rajasthan and Uttar Pradesh. The Alstom technologies implemented in this project will cut down the commute time to half and change the lives of millions in the National capital region.

In early 2023, Alstom’s first semi-high-speed rapid rail transit system, which is a first-of-its-kind worldwide in digitalization and automation technologies, is set to be operational. It will connect Sahibabad and Duhai, the priority section of India’s first Regional Rapid Transit System (RRTS) line, Delhi- Ghaziabad-Meerut corridor.

The RRTS project aims to address social and economic issues and promote balanced and sustainable economic development in the National Capital Region. This corridor will eventually reduce the journey time between Delhi and Meerut to less than 60 minutes, compared to the current 90-120 minutes. The train will have a maximum speed of 180 kmph, and it will run in ~5-10-minute intervals. With 3-6 cars, each allowing for more than 200standing and sitting passengers, this line will deliver enormous passenger capacity that will transform the region. This is what National Capital Region Transport Corporation (NCRTC) and Alstom are set to achieve starting early next year.

The first phase of the Delhi-Ghaziabad-Meerut corridor will be operational early next year with 5 rail stations along the 20 km stretch between Delhi and Ghaziabad (Sahibabad, Ghaziabad, Guldhar, Duhai and Duhai Depot). The entire 82 km corridor will eventually include 25 stations of semi-highspeed rail (RRTS) and metro service (MRTS). It will have elevated as well as underground stations and connect several areas in the urban center of Delhi to stations in Ghaziabad and Meerut. All of this is intended to be fully operation in 2024.

This project will not only improve the lives of tens of millions but also become a worldwide reference as Alstom premieres implementation of state-of-the-art advanced systems and innovative technologies. This solution will redefine the future of mainline and metro railways through digitalisation and automation.

The Delhi-Ghaziabad-Meerut Corridor operates on Alstom’s ETCS Level 3 Hybrid system and includes two contingency degraded modes, ETCS Level 1 and Interlocking mechanisms. The system incorporates Automatic Train Operation (ATO) over Long Term Evolution (LTE) radio, both are integrated with ETCS for the first time. To provide utmost safety to passengers, a Platform Screen Door (PSD), requiring a stopping accuracy of 30 cm, has been incorporated for the first time with the ETCS solution. This will make RRTS one of the most advanced signalling and train control systems in the world.

It also has a salient feature – its interoperability that will facilitate seamless commuter movement across corridors, without the hassle of changing trains. This ETCS signalling system will be a key enabler in ensuring interoperability and train movement at quick frequencies.
